The Thunder have the Utah Jazz’s first-round pick from a 2021 deal that allowed the Jazz to shed salary by sending Derrick Favors to the Thunder. That pick is top-eight protected, so if the Jazz pick later than eighth, their pick goes to Oklahoma City.
